你查询的IP:[116.4.238.219]  地理位置:中国–广东–东莞

最新查询211.160.233.159 124.14.62.126 124.196.236.254 119.108.209.103 123.196.16.25 202.127.58.53 121.37.16.124 202.112.1.165 119.57.97.243 116.4.238.219 119.88.113.86 125.169.253.211 119.112.220.23 123.96.55.231 121.89.199.10 203.208.22.67 116.213.128.224 119.28.199.135 202.131.48.158 202.136.48.91 116.89.144.174 202.168.160.244 125.96.18.125 203.100.192.205 123.8.115.61 124.172.224.179 119.226.137.105 125.64.40.49 221.13.240.80 60.235.156.189 202.38.176.155